Davidson and Lowry Place at Modesto- Cougars Finish 8th, Next Up The Meathead Mover Classic

Cuesta's Grapplers were busy last week with a pair of duals in Victorville on Wednesday and the Modesto Tournament at the opposite end of the State on Saturday.  The Cougars dropped both their duals, dropping their SouthEast Conference match-up, 47-13 to the host Rams and falling to Palomar, 46-12, in a non-conference dual.  Freshman Andres Cervanteswas the only Cougar to win a match in each dual.  Three days later in Modesto the Cougars took 8th place among the 13 teams, while posting a combined 14-17 mark among their eight entrants.  Freshman Christian Davidson and 2022 State Qualifier Reily Lowry both placed for the Cougars.  Davidson proved to be the Cougars' top placer after reaching the title match at 197.  He posted a 3-1 mark and took 2nd place.  Lowry also claimed three victories as he took 5th place with a 3-2 record at 174.  

Wrestling takes a break this weekend and is back in action for a SEC Dual at Bakersfield on October 18 (6 PM).  That week, Cuesta also hosts East LA for a SEC Dual the Friday (6 PM) before the 20th Meathead Mover Wrestling Invitational on Saturday, October 21.
